Given Input Data is 510, 693, 272, 764
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 510 is 2 x 3 x 5 x 17
Prime Factorization of 693 is 3 x 3 x 7 x 11
Prime Factorization of 272 is 2 x 2 x 2 x 2 x 17
Prime Factorization of 764 is 2 x 2 x 191
The above numbers do not have any common prime factor. So GCD is 1
